Carthage Area Hospital: Expert Care & Advanced Medical Services

Carthage Area Hospital delivers comprehensive acute and chronic care to residents of Carthage and surrounding counties. The facility combines emergency services, surgical capabilities, and outpatient programs under one coordinated medical staff.

Community partnerships and clinician-led initiatives help the hospital maintain high performance metrics while focusing on patient-centered communication and accessible preventive care.

Emergency Department Operations

The emergency department at Carthage Area Hospital operates around the clock with board-certified emergency physicians and trauma-trained nurses. Rapid triage protocols ensure that life-threatening conditions receive immediate attention while maintaining efficient throughput for lower-acuity visits.

Advanced diagnostics, including CT imaging and on-site laboratory testing, support fast decision-making for strokes, cardiac events, and severe infections. Staff coordinate closely with air and ground ambulance teams to facilitate timely transfers when higher-level care is required.

Surgical Services and Patient Safety

Common Procedures and Specialties

General, orthopedic, and gynecologic surgeries are performed regularly, with anesthesia support and post-op monitoring aligned with national safety checklists. Collaboration with larger academic centers provides access to specialized surgical subspecialties when needed.

Infection Control and Sterilization

Central line and surgical site infection rates are monitored monthly, with feedback provided to clinical teams to drive continuous improvement. Strict hand hygiene compliance and environmental cleaning protocols help protect vulnerable surgical patients.

Primary Care and Chronic Disease Management

Primary care providers serve as the central point for preventive health, routine screenings, and management of diabetes, hypertension, and asthma. Care plans are individualized and reviewed at every visit to align treatment targets with patient preferences.

Integrated behavioral health services connect patients with counseling and stress management resources, addressing both physical and emotional needs. Remote monitoring for chronic conditions enables early intervention and reduces avoidable hospital readmissions.

Outpatient Rehabilitation and Therapy Programs

Inpatient and outpatient rehabilitation services focus on restoring mobility, strength, and independence after injury or surgery. Multidisciplinary teams tailor exercise programs, pain management strategies, and assistive device training to each patient’s goals.

Outpatient therapy slots are available by referral, with flexible scheduling to accommodate work and family responsibilities. Progress is tracked using standardized functional measures, and adjustments are made based on patient feedback and outcomes.

How quickly are emergency room wait times at Carthage Area Hospital?

Wait times vary by acuity level, with critical cases seen immediately and average door-to-provider times under 15 minutes for high-acuity emergencies.

Can I schedule imaging or specialty appointments through Carthage Area Hospital?

Appointments for MRI, CT scans, and specialty clinics can be scheduled through your provider or directly via the hospital’s outpatient scheduling line.

What infection prevention measures are in place at Carthage Area Hospital?

The hospital follows strict hand hygiene, environmental disinfection, and isolation protocols for contagious conditions to minimize infection risk for patients and visitors.

Are telehealth services available for follow-up visits at Carthage Area Hospital?

Yes, many follow-up appointments, chronic disease checks, and behavioral health sessions are offered via secure video visits for patient convenience.
